Over the past few months, the world has been reeling with the aftermath of a deadly virus called Coronavirus. The business has taken a nosedive in almost all the industries. Though most of the restrictions imposed by the countries are necessary to stem the impact of the disease, we also need to understand the impact they will have on the sales of most of the companies around the world. However, you need to also understand that it is the time to invest in advertising as consumers still need to eat and consume. Start thinking out of the box to keep your customers rolling along with you. Let us explore some ways as to how you can do so:

Deploy your Company’s Thought Leaders

This restriction time, when meetings and trade shows are getting canceled, offers you the luxury to take a step back and think about the bigger picture. This creative thought process is necessary in today’s times when face to face meetings are getting canceled. It gives us time to analyze and tackle the big issues that your industry is facing, something you didn’t have time to fix when things were going smoothly. Led by your top executives, set up virtual informational webinars to replace the canceled trade shows. Featuring online executive-level talk tracks, it will help the people in the industry through thought leadership. After all, it is one of the top reasons why people travel for conferences around the world.

Check-in with your customers

Get your sales representatives their own official video conferencing account so that they can chat with the stuck at home customers in virtual meetings. Ask them how they are facing the crisis and how your company can help them. If they are expecting your company to deliver products and services in the wake of this lockdown that you are unable to fulfill, discuss with them the strategies you have once all this is over. It is important for a strong brand image that the customers hear of these plans right from the horse’s mouth individually. Not only will this help in a strong brand positioning after the business is normal again, these ones on one meeting will help your sales team to identify which customers have been most affected by the crisis and what you can do to help them after this passes over. In case yours is a B2B company, these video conferences will further help your clients to strategize and explain the plans to their own customers.

Schedule Future product demos

A new year is a time for strategizing and making future plans of investments. However, these have now been delayed considering the volatile market condition. This further hobbles the growth plans for many companies. You can shorten these delays by organizing open webinars where they can learn more about your technology and see live hands-on demonstrations. You can also consider joint demos if your company is fully integrated with several other platform providers. Ask your sales team to market the link for these video meetings and keep them open so that anyone with the link can drop by at any time of the meeting.

Start an online networking community

People travel all around the world for conferences so that they get to meet their peers and discuss upcoming industry practices and ask questions. In fact, for most people, networking is the top reason for attending these conferences. You can help them in this endeavor by starting an online community where your customers can engage in a peer to peer discussion with the top executives of your firm. However, do not keep it just for the crisis. Make it a regular forum for your customers and it will surely pay in the long run for your business. There are several plug and play services available that will help you in the setting up of the same as quickly as possible.

Market Communication

In this when everyone is feeling socially isolated, you can tie your content marketing initiatives with your social media strategies so that you stay connected with your audience.

Never waste even a single moment of a crisis. Even though travel is restricted and business is slow, you will have a lot more time in your hands to better your brand in the market. Employ the tools available in your hand for a stronger brand positioning in the market. One way you can do the same is by engaging with your industry peers by writing thought to invoke leadership articles in industry-specific publications. Share your vision of any future opportunities you feel there is to seize, future growth trends of the industry, and the roadblocks ahead. In order to have an active market communication, keep your social media channels engaging and active. Not only will it help you in staying connected with your customers, but it will also help you in communicating with them regarding the latest news and your expertise. In these times when everyone is feeling socially isolated, you can tie your content marketing initiatives with your social media strategies so that you stay connected with your audience. Another way of communicating your message is by podcasts. These help you in telling your brand story to an interested audience willing to listen to the same while opening up new avenues for you to explore. Get invited into one of the industry-specific ones as an expert guest or you can even try starting your podcast channel.

Optimize your website content

This lockdown also gives us the opportunity to improvise the website experience for your audience. Optimize the website content by making sure that it communicates a relevant message and speaks to customer concerns. It should be up to date and relevant and you can add to the same by including blogs, videos, posts, and customer success stories.
